AngularJS 1 是一种流行的 JavaScript 前端框架,它通过组件化编程的方式帮助开发人员构建可维护和可扩展的应用程序。本文将深入探讨 AngularJS 1 组件化编程的概念、原则和实践,并提供相应的源代码示例。
组件化编程是一种将应用程序划分为独立、可复用和可测试的组件的方法。在 AngularJS 1 中,组件由控制器(Controller)、模型(Model)和视图(View)组成。控制器负责处理业务逻辑,模型存储数据,视图负责展示用户界面。
让我们从创建一个简单的组件开始。首先,我们需要在 HTML 页面中引入 AngularJS 库:
<script src="https://ajax.googleapis.com/ajax/libs/angularjs/1.7.9/angular.min.js">
本文详细介绍了AngularJS 1的组件化编程,包括组件构成(控制器、模型和视图)、数据绑定、指令、过滤器和服务的使用。通过实例演示如何创建和管理组件,阐述了AngularJS 1如何提升代码的可维护性和可扩展性。虽然AngularJS 1已过时,但理解其组件化编程原理对前端开发者仍有价值。
订阅专栏 解锁全文
234

被折叠的 条评论
为什么被折叠?



